Summary

The case involves a conflict between two former best friends, Félix and Héctor, due to Félix's son impregnating Héctor's daughter. Félix sues Héctor to take responsibility for his pregnant daughter, who is living with Félix. The situation is complicated by the teenagers' claim that the pregnancy was planned to force their families into supporting their desire to start a family at a young age. The judge orders Héctor to take his daughter home and make decisions regarding their children's future, highlighting the lack of parental supervision and communication that led to this situation.
